MULTIFUNCTIONAL PORTABLE TOOL AND PERSONAL CARE APPARATUS
A multifunctional portable tool is provided, which includes a housing; a motor received in the housing and having a first output end; a pump head movably received in the housing and having a driven shaft that is connectable with the first output end; and a first reset mechanism disposed between the motor and the pump head. The multifunctional portable tool has a first working state in which the driven shaft of the pump head is connected with the first output end of the motor so that the pump head and the motor together function as a pump, and a second working state in which the pump head is driven by the first reset mechanism to move away from the motor until the driven shaft of the pump head is disconnected with the first output end of the motor.

NASAL IRRIGATION DEVICE AND SYSTEM WITH FAUX COLLAPSIBLE CARTRIDGE ELEMENT
A nasal irrigation device communicates an irrigant to a device user and comprises a mechanics module and a reservoir assembly wherein a source of saline comprising a cartridge is disposed within the mechanics module adjacent a lid assembly for piercing the cartridge upon closing of a lid for releasing the cartridge contents into the reservoir assembly. A faux collapsible cartridge for testing operability of a nasal irrigation device comprises a housing including a shaft, a spring biased rod extending from the housing shaft, and a flange depending from a housing wall whereby the rod and flange are disposed to actuate a trigger assembly of the nasal irrigation device.

POSITIVE-PRESSURE DOUBLE-NOZZLE NASAL CAVITY CLEANER FEATURING DOUBLE PRESSURE PROTECTION AND USE METHOD THEREOF
The present invention discloses a positive-pressure double-nozzle nasal cavity cleaner featuring double pressure protection, and relates to the technical field of health care. The nasal cavity cleaner consists of a nose washing end, an upper shell, a core module, a control module, a lower shell, a liquid reservoir and a waste reservoir, wherein the nose washing end is rotatably connected to a top portion of the upper shell, and the nose washing end consists of a silicone washing nozzle, a silicone backflow nozzle and a rotary connecting base. The nasal cavity cleaner uses positive pressure and automatic pressure relief structures to obtain safe and constant air pressure, and then presses normal saline into the nasal cavity to clean the nasal cavity, so that pressure in the nasal cavity is small and stable during cleaning, which prevents damage to the nasal cavity and ear canal, thus being safer to use. Besides, deeper areas can be washed, nasal scabs in the nasal cavity can be moistened and removed, harmful substances such as dust in the nasal cavity can be removed, the nasal cavity can be moistened, and normal swing of nasal cilia can be recovered, which are helpful in treating rhinitis and preventing the onset of allergic rhinitis.

NASAL IRRIGATION ASSEMBLY AND SYSTEM
An assembly for nasal irrigation for the handheld irrigation of a user's nasal cavity comprising a housing with a refill chamber containing irrigating fluid, an applicator, an actuator for forcing irrigating fluid from the refill chamber through the applicator into the user's nasal cavity during operation, and a solution port for refilling the refill chamber. Some embodiments of the present invention may further comprise a system for nasal irrigation that includes the assembly for nasal irrigation or handheld irrigator, as well as a solution assembly structured for dispensing irrigating fluid to the handheld irrigator, a docking station for removably housing the handheld irrigator, a solution assembly and a refill control, including a check valve.
COLAPSIBLE NASAL EJECTING CATHETER
A collapsible nasal ejecting catheter, made of thermoplastic elastomer or other soft and elastic material, can be operated by the patients to insert into their nasal cavity and nasopharynx. The catheter includes a catheter body and a connector. The catheter has a flat closed distal end, a transitional segment starting from the closed end to a circular appearance, a normal segment having a circular appearance, and an open end on the opposite side of the flat closed end. There are multiple side-holes near the closed end. This catheter, when adapted to a connector and further connected to a syringe, can eject multiple strong thin spouts within the nasal cavity and nasopharynx for cleansing mucus and crust. The maximum width of the transitional segment is not less than 1 mm, and the minimum wall thickness of the catheter is not larger than 0.45 mm. Due to the flat closed distal end and transitional segment of the catheter body and its flexibility, the catheter with a larger outer diameter can be smoothly inserted into the slit-like space, reaching a deep depth to produce a better flushing efficiency, and also avoiding accidental entry into the sinus.

THERAPEUTIC DEVICE FOR TREATMENT OF CONDITIONS RELATING TO THE SINUSES, NASAL CAVITIES, EAR, NOSE AND THROAT
A therapeutic device for treating conditions of a user's nasal cavities, sinuses, and/or ear canals includes a housing which the user may hold to apply the therapeutic device to the user, the housing including an inlet that allows air to enter the therapeutic device. An acoustic vibrator located within the housing provides an acoustic vibration to the user, and a power supply located within the housing provides power to the acoustic vibrator. A mask is connected to the housing and includes a nasal interface that is appliable around the nose of the user. A valve of the mask opens to allow the user to breathe through the inlet and closes to prevent the user from exhaling through the inlet. The mask further includes a diaphragm and a nasal cavity in which a user's nostrils are located when the nasal interface is applied to the user.
